Articles of list

Clasificación de listas de Java: ¿hay alguna manera de mantener una lista ordenada de manera permanente como TreeMap?

En Java puedes construir una ArrayList con elementos y luego llamar: Collections.sort(list, comparator); ¿Hay alguna forma de pasar el Comparador en el momento de la creación de la Lista como lo puede hacer con TreeMap? El objective es poder agregar un elemento a la lista y en lugar de tenerlo adjunto automáticamente al final de […]

¿Cómo hacer que el método Java devuelva una lista genérica de cualquier tipo?

Me gustaría escribir un método que devuelva un java.util.List de cualquier tipo sin la necesidad de encasillar algo : List users = magicalListGetter(User.class); List vehicles = magicalListGetter(Vehicle.class); List strings = magicalListGetter(String.class); ¿Cómo se vería la firma del método? Algo como esto, tal vez (?): public List< ?> magicalListGetter(Class clazz) { List list = doMagicalVooDooHere(); return […]

¿Son posibles 2 listas dimensionales en c #?

Me gustaría establecer una lista multidimensional. Como referencia, estoy trabajando en un analizador de lista de reproducción. Tengo un archivo / lista de archivos, que mi progtwig guarda en una lista estándar. Una línea del archivo en cada entrada de la lista. Luego analizo la lista con expresiones regulares para encontrar líneas específicas. Algunos de […]

División de lista en sublistas a lo largo de los elementos

Tengo esta lista ( List ): [“a”, “b”, null, “c”, null, “d”, “e”] Y me gustaría algo como esto: [[“a”, “b”], [“c”], [“d”, “e”]] En otras palabras, quiero dividir mi lista en sublistas usando el valor null como separador, para obtener una lista de listas ( List<List> ). Estoy buscando una solución Java 8. Lo […]

¿Cómo transmitir desde la Lista al doble en Java?

Tengo una variable como esa: List frameList = new ArrayList(); /* Double elements has added to frameList */ ¿Cómo puedo tener una nueva variable con un tipo de double[] de esa variable en Java con alto rendimiento?

Segregando listas en Prolog

Me está costando mucho trabajo entender cómo obtener mi código para mostrar mis listas segregadas que constan de números pares e impares. Ni siquiera estoy seguro de lo que me falta de comprensión. Soy nuevo en este lenguaje obviamente y debo usarlo para la escuela. Mi mente imperativa y funcional no me deja saber qué […]

Cómo extender una lista de Scala para permitir el corte no por posición explícita sino por predicado / condición dada

por trait Item case class TypeA(i: Int) extends Item case class TypeB(i: Int) extends Item considere una lista de elementos de Scala como val myList = List(TypeA(1), TypeB(11), TypeB(12), TypeA(2), TypeB(21), TypeA(3), TypeB(31)) El objective es definir un nuevo método de slice que se pueda aplicar a myList y que tome un predicado o condición […]

XmlSerializer serialize genérica Lista de interfaz

Estoy tratando de usar el XmlSerializer para mantener una Lista (T) donde T es una interfaz. El serializador no le gusta las interfaces. Tengo curiosidad de saber si existe una forma sencilla de serializar fácilmente una lista de objetos heterogéneos con XmlSerializer. Esto es lo que estoy buscando: public interface IAnimal { int Age(); } […]

¿Una lista garantiza que los artículos serán devueltos en el orden en que fueron agregados?

¿Una List siempre garantiza que los artículos serán devueltos en el orden en que se agregaron cuando se enumeraron? Actualizado : Gracias por todas las respuestas, tranquiliza mi mente. Hice una rápida búsqueda de la clase List con .NET Reflector (probablemente debería haberlo hecho en primer lugar) y, de hecho, la tienda subyacente es una […]

¿Cómo verificar si se ordena una lista?

Estoy haciendo algunas pruebas unitarias y quiero saber si hay alguna manera de probar si una lista está ordenada por una propiedad de los objetos que contiene. En este momento lo estoy haciendo de esta manera, pero no me gusta, quiero una mejor manera. ¿Puede alguien ayudarme por favor? // (fill the list) List studyFeeds […]